In this guide, we\u2019ll explore what business analytics software actually is, the tools worth knowing in 2026, and a framework for picking the right one for an Indian organization.<\/p>\n\n\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>What is business analytics software?<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Business analytics software is a category of platforms that help organizations collect, process, visualize, and interpret data to support decisions.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>These tools sit at the intersection of business intelligence and data science. A dashboard that only shows what happened last quarter is reporting. Software that also explains why it happened and what is likely to happen next is analytics.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>At its core, business analytics software does four things: pulls data from CRM, ERP, surveys, and other systems into one place, applies statistical or AI-driven models to find patterns, turns those patterns into dashboards non-technical staff can read, and keeps that data secure and accurate through governance controls.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Business analytics vs. business intelligence vs. business analysis<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>These three terms get used interchangeably in vendor marketing, which causes real confusion when a team is trying to scope a purchase.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div style=\"overflow-x:auto;margin:1.5rem 0;\">\n  <table style=\"border-collapse:collapse;width:100%;table-layout:auto;\">\n    <thead>\n      <tr>\n        <th style=\"background:#1a2b5e;color:#fff;padding:10px 14px;border:1px solid #C5CFE8;font-size:18px;text-align:left;white-space:nowrap;\">Term<\/th>\n        <th style=\"background:#162450;color:#fff;padding:10px 14px;border:1px solid #C5CFE8;font-size:18px;text-align:left;\">What it means<\/th>\n        <th style=\"background:#1a2b5e;color:#fff;padding:10px 14px;border:1px solid #C5CFE8;font-size:18px;text-align:left;\">Example output<\/th>\n      <\/tr>\n    <\/thead>\n    <tbody>\n      <tr>\n        <td style=\"background:#ffffff;padding:9px 14px;border:1px solid #E5E7EB;font-size:16px;vertical-align:top;font-weight:600;word-wrap:break-word;white-space:nowrap;\">Business intelligence (BI)<\/td>\n        <td style=\"background:#f0f4ff;padding:9px 14px;border:1px solid #E5E7EB;font-size:16px;vertical-align:top;word-wrap:break-word;\">Describes what happened using historical data<\/td>\n        <td style=\"background:#ffffff;padding:9px 14px;border:1px solid #E5E7EB;font-size:16px;vertical-align:top;word-wrap:break-word;\">A sales dashboard showing last month&#8217;s revenue by region<\/td>\n      <\/tr>\n      <tr>\n        <td style=\"background:#ffffff;padding:9px 14px;border:1px solid #E5E7EB;font-size:16px;vertical-align:top;font-weight:600;word-wrap:break-word;white-space:nowrap;\">Business analytics<\/td>\n        <td style=\"background:#f0f4ff;padding:9px 14px;border:1px solid #E5E7EB;font-size:16px;vertical-align:top;word-wrap:break-word;\">Explains why it happened and predicts what happens next<\/td>\n        <td style=\"background:#ffffff;padding:9px 14px;border:1px solid #E5E7EB;font-size:16px;vertical-align:top;word-wrap:break-word;\">A model forecasting next quarter&#8217;s churn rate<\/td>\n      <\/tr>\n      <tr>\n        <td style=\"background:#ffffff;padding:9px 14px;border:1px solid #E5E7EB;font-size:16px;vertical-align:top;font-weight:600;word-wrap:break-word;white-space:nowrap;\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.questionpro.com\/blog\/business-analysis\/\">Business analysis<\/a><\/td>\n        <td style=\"background:#f0f4ff;padding:9px 14px;border:1px solid #E5E7EB;font-size:16px;vertical-align:top;word-wrap:break-word;\">A broader discipline for diagnosing organizational problems, not a software category<\/td>\n        <td style=\"background:#ffffff;padding:9px 14px;border:1px solid #E5E7EB;font-size:16px;vertical-align:top;word-wrap:break-word;\">A gap analysis comparing current and desired process states<\/td>\n      <\/tr>\n    <\/tbody>\n  <\/table>\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<p>Most modern platforms blur these lines. Power BI now includes predictive features, and QuestionPro&#8217;s survey analytics includes both descriptive dashboards and statistical significance testing. The label on the tool matters less than what question you need answered. For more on the reporting side of this distinction, see<a href=\"https:\/\/www.questionpro.com\/blog\/analytics-vs-reporting\/\"> analytics vs. reporting<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>The 4 types of business analytics<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Understanding these four types matters before evaluating any platform, because each type needs different underlying technology.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Descriptive analytics<\/strong> answers &#8220;what happened.&#8221; A retail chain reviewing last month&#8217;s foot traffic by store is running descriptive analytics.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Diagnostic analytics<\/strong> answers &#8220;why did it happen.&#8221; An FMCG brand drilling into why its Net Promoter Score dropped after a packaging change is running diagnostic analytics.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Predictive analytics<\/strong> answers &#8220;what will happen.&#8221; A BFSI firm scoring which loan applicants are likely to default is running predictive analytics.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Prescriptive analytics<\/strong> answers &#8220;what should we do.&#8221; A logistics company simulating three delivery routes to pick the cheapest one is running prescriptive analytics.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Most organizations operate mainly in the first two modes. Moving into predictive and prescriptive territory usually means investing in either a statistical platform or an AI-assisted analytics tool. For a closer look at how AI is changing this shift, read our guide on<a href=\"https:\/\/www.questionpro.com\/blog\/ai-analytics\/\"> AI analytics<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Business analytics software categories and tools to know<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>The market splits into four functional categories, and knowing which one you actually need narrows the search fast.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Survey and research analytics platforms<\/strong> capture primary data, meaning direct input from customers, employees, or markets that transaction logs cannot provide. QuestionPro is one of the established platforms here for Indian market research and corporate research teams, with survey distribution across online, CAPI, CATI, and CAWI modes, built-in statistical testing, and API connections into Power BI and Tableau.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>BI and visualization tools<\/strong> connect to structured data and produce dashboards. Power BI leads India&#8217;s enterprise market on Microsoft 365 pricing and ecosystem fit. Tableau leads on visualization depth. Looker Studio is free and popular with SMBs. Zoho Analytics, built by Chennai-based Zoho Corporation, suits Indian businesses already inside the Zoho ecosystem.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Statistical tools<\/strong> serve data scientists. R and Python are free, open-source standards for predictive modeling. SAS remains entrenched in Indian BFSI and pharma, and SPSS is common in social science and market research.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Operational analytics<\/strong> covers narrower jobs: CRM analytics inside Salesforce or HubSpot, web analytics through Google Analytics 4, and feedback analytics through platforms like QuestionPro Customer Experience.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 shortlisting, since they reflect verified user feedback rather than vendor claims.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>How to choose business analytics software: Key features to evaluate<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Feature checklists are easy to find and hard to act on. These five questions cut through the noise faster.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Can it connect to your actual data sources?<\/strong><br>The best platforms in 2026 offer native connectors to CRM, ERP, spreadsheets, and survey tools, plus clean APIs for anything custom. A platform that cannot ingest your existing systems will need costly custom integration work later.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Does it match your team&#8217;s technical skill level?<\/strong><br>R, Python, and SAS reward technical depth but have steep learning curves. Looker Studio and Power BI trade some analytical depth for accessibility. Map the tool to who will actually use it day to day, not to who evaluated it.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Will the output make sense to its audience?<\/strong><br>A CFO needs an executive summary. A data analyst needs model diagnostics underneath it. The same platform should serve both without forcing a compromise.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Does it support real collaboration?<\/strong><br>Cloud platforms let multiple stakeholders view, annotate, and act on the same analysis. Desktop-first tools tend to create version-control headaches once more than two people are involved.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>What is the true cost of ownership?<\/strong><br>License price is one line item. Implementation, training, and integration work are the rest of the bill, and a tool that looks expensive per seat can be cheaper overall once those costs are included.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Business analytics in action: A practical example<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Consider a mid-sized FMCG brand in India selling through both retail and e-commerce. Its sales dashboard shows a 12 percent revenue dip in one region over a quarter, a descriptive finding.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Diagnostic analysis on the same data traces the dip to a specific product line and a spike in returns. A quick pulse survey to affected customers, run through a research analytics platform, surfaces a packaging complaint the transaction data alone never would have shown.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>That combination, structured BI data plus direct customer feedback, is what separates a team that reacts to numbers from one that understands them. Neither tool alone would have surfaced the full picture.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>What Indian businesses need from analytics software<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Three factors shape which platform actually works for organizations operating in India, beyond the standard feature list.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Multilingual data collection: <\/strong>India&#8217;s research base spans more than a dozen major languages. Platforms that support Hindi, Tamil, Telugu, Bengali, and Marathi data collection produce more representative results than English-only tools.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Mobile-first delivery: <\/strong>With smartphone use far outpacing desktop use across the country, analytics and survey tools need offline-capable, mobile-optimized modes to reach respondents in tier-2 and tier-3 cities reliably.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Local pricing and support: <\/strong>Indian buyers weigh cost differently than markets in the US or Europe, and rupee-denominated pricing with a local support team tends to matter as much as the feature set itself.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Demand for<a href=\"https:\/\/www.statista.com\/outlook\/tmo\/software\/enterprise-software\/business-intelligence-software\/india\"> business intelligence software in India<\/a> has grown steadily as more companies move toward cloud-based, self-service analytics rather than IT-managed reporting, according to Statista&#8217;s market outlook.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Common mistakes when selecting business analytics tools<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>A handful of avoidable mistakes account for most failed analytics rollouts.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Choosing features over fit.<\/strong><br>A team that primarily needs survey analytics does not need a full data warehouse and BI stack. Match the tool to the task in front of you, not the most impressive demo.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Underestimating adoption costs.<\/strong><br>Analytics projects often fail because end users were never trained, not because the software was weak. Budget for change management alongside the license.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Treating software as a substitute for methodology.<\/strong><br>A sophisticated platform cannot fix a poorly designed survey or a biased sample. The research design matters as much as the tool.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Siloing tools by department.<\/strong><br>When marketing, sales, HR, and research each run separate platforms with no integration, the result is fragmented and sometimes contradictory intelligence.<br><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Delaying governance.<\/strong><br>Retrofitting access controls and data privacy compliance onto a mature analytics platform is far harder than building it in from day one.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>How QuestionPro fits into a business analytics stack<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Dedicated BI tools are strong at analyzing internal, transactional data.
